What books do you read?

We read a mix of non-fiction and fiction that spark big thinking. Themes include personal growth, vulnerability, mindfulness, leadership, joy, and work-life integration. The books are chosen to stretch us, open us up, and help us reflect. For example, we've read 'The Power of Now' by Ekhart Toll, 'Daring Greatly' by Brene Brown, 'The Alchemist' by Paulo Coelho and 'The Midnight Library' by Matt Haigh. Each month, we each have the chance to suggest new books that might help shake things up, and vote on which we're going to read.

How much does it cost?

Book club membership costs £20 per month, which includes coffee and a scone. You’re not just paying to talk about a book, you’re investing in a space for reflection, connection, and meaningful personal growth. This isn’t your average networking or business event. It’s time out of the daily crap to reconnect with what matters, challenge your thinking, and leave with fresh insight and energy you can take back into life and work.

We also offer 20% off most book selections through our partnership with local bookshop Bookends. So you can support a local bookshop while saving on your reading.
